Grizzlycorps Program Coordinator

Current

GrizzlyCorps is an AmeriCorps program administered by UC Berkeley’s Center for Law, Energy, and the Environment in partnership with CaliforniaVolunteers. Our program sends recent college graduates into rural communities across California to promote regenerative agri-food systems and fire and forest resilience. We aim to expand capacity for organizations working on community resilience and climate action while bolstering the next generation of professionals at the forefront of climate change solutions. As Program Coordinator, I oversee event planning, develop & facilitate training curriculum, and support program communication & day-to-day operations.
